So I just got my first S. Haddoni and I am stoked. I got a screaming deal on him and I hope I can revive him. He was rescued from a ten gallon sump that had inadequate lighting. Not to mention half of him was in a shadow caused by tubing down there. So half is bleached a bit but is doing a lot better in my system.

He is aprox 2-3 inches in diameter. He footed immediately in my sand and has not moved. I have had him for 2 nights now and he has perked up tremendously. I feed him a few bit of finely cut fresh Cobia and he "inhaled" them. Very sticky tentacles and an awesome appetite. I am very pleased.

Nice color, what LEDs are you upgrading to? Go slow with the increase of light. I run my 2 AI Sols at 45%W, 55%B, 55%RB and my blue haddoni is doing great (20" deep tank)
 
Thanks for the compliments. Evergrow Lighting. I plan on starting out with them very dim and very slowly increasing to say 50-75% in a month or so. My LFS never carries any "exotic" anemones. Only Condy with occasional LTA. I Love my Haddoni! I pick him up from Craigslist haha more like rescued him as you can see from my pictures
 
Sounds good. I don't think I am going to increase mine any more than they are. When you do the increases only do 3-5% increases, I know people that have had issues when trying to do 8-10% increases especially when they were getting to the 60-80% range.
